Output 17cb92c511ee664a260c6fcee19688dcac96ab6e7395fe7966f2a2fe8a503028:1

value
577618892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750b686cde947599fc8308ff9cec251e230be5da OP_EQUAL
address
3CMted7e6N7XrZZ4aRghJVWRx4gNiCEdTU
transaction
17cb92c511ee664a260c6fcee19688dcac96ab6e7395fe7966f2a2fe8a503028
spent
true